Let T be the region in the first quadrant bounded by the graphs of f(x)= cos x and g(x)= e^-2x

(a) Find the area of T.


(b) Region T is the base of a solid. For this solid, the cross-section perpendicular to the x-axis are semi-circles with diameters extending from y=f(x) to y=g(x). Find the volume of this solid.
